Israel vs Papua New Guinea statistics compared

Updated on by Georank team

Israel has a population of 9.97M (ranked 96/197), compared with 10.6M in Papua New Guinea (ranked 92/197). Israel's land area is 8,355 sq mi versus 174,850 sq mi for Papua New Guinea (ranked 149th vs. 54th).

By GDP, Israel ranks 29/197 ($540B) and Papua New Guinea ranks 110/197 ($31.8B). By GDP per capita, Israel ranks 21/197 ($54,177), while Papua New Guinea ranks 140/197 ($3,007).
